Rear Button Focus - Nikon Film Bodies
Jan 20, 2018 05:47:53   #
Shutterbug57
 
Most Nikon DSLRs can decouple the focus from the shutter button and work only with the AF on button. Are there any Nikon film SLR bodies that can use this functionality? My N90s will not work this way. I appreciate your input.

The F5 you can do that and use the AE-L/AF-L button but you have to set it up in custom settings. I believe the F6 which is newer would do the same.
